Page 64 - 计算机应用软件开发技术研究
P. 64

计算机应用软件开发技术研究
            Research on Computer Application Software Development Technology

                3.加强各个功能的联系
                分层技术运用在计算机软件设计过程中,能够将各个部分和各个层次之间相
            关联,从而能达到计算机系统整体运行的稳定性。并运用强化服务技术,提高计

            算机系统整体运行的能力,从而也提高计算机软件的整体性能,加强了服务器与
            效率之间的联系,提高计算机软件在使用过程中的稳定性。
                (二)分层技术在计算机软件开发中的应用
                随着信息技术的不断发展,计算机的应用也比较广泛,在某种程度上看,已

            经达到了普及,因为计算机能满足人们的实际需求,从而也促使计算机软件的功
            能要不断开发来满足人们的需求,但分层技术在计算机软件发展同时在某种程度
            上也得到发展。分层技术在计算机软件开发中是一种重要的趋势,与此同时,计
            算机在运行中也受到了分层技术大力支持,使分层技术在计算机软件功能中变得

            更强大,也为人们生活和工作带来了便利条件。而计算机软件系统主要是能进行
            分层,并建立在物理硬件和底层构件联系上,但从计算机软件整体角度上来看,
            要不断对计算机软件进行优化处理,让上下层之间产生依赖,实现一些功能。但
            为了提高计算机软件质量,要保证分层技术的稳定性。

                1.双层结构技术
                双层技术构成的流程主要包括两个部分,分别是服务器和客户端。其中服务
            器的作用主要是接收客户端信息,并在数据库中进行查找和计算,最后将结果反
            馈给客户端。而客户端作用主要是为用户提供一些界面,处理逻辑上的关系。例

            如:双向数据计算的关系能够在用户少和在服务器充足时间下,进行计算,能发
            挥出重要的作用。如果用户多并且服务器没有充足反应时间,那么双层结构技术
            就没有起到作用,会给用户带来了不便。
                2.三层结构技术

                三层结构主要是在双层结构的基础上不断拓展和延伸,在服务器和客户端上
            增加了服务器端,提高计算机服务系统工作效果。而服务器端主要作用就是在客
            户端逻辑关系处理上移到本端口中,客户端只要能把所提供的页面做好,那么也
            提升用户人机交互运用效果。三层结构是:界面层、业务处理层和数据处理层。

            界面层功能主要是能够收集用户对软件的需求,并传递给业务处理层,业务处理
            层主要功能是接受用户需求并具体分析,之后向数据处理层提取相关数据进行处
            理,最后将处理结果反馈给界面层。数据处理层功能主要是在接收业务处理层申



            ·52·
   59   60   61   62   63   64   65   66   67   68   69